This chapter proposes a social re-embedding of European constitutionalism by offering a coherent interpretation of EU constitutional principles as contained in the initial articles of the Treaties and the EU’s economic and social constitution as developed by the Court of Justice. It starts from the assumption that European integration is not merely an inter-state endeavour, but also a process that affects social and economic actors, in other words societies all over Europe. It may well ultimately engender a European society – if we are prepared to conceive of a poly-centric society, consisting of diverse components from a wide range of regions, social actors and cultures. Proceeding from the assumption that constitutionalism can be a relevant notion for such a holistic approach to European integration, the chapter develops elements of European constitutionalism relating to socio-economic reality. As national constitutional law, European constitutional law is presented as necessarily incomplete. European constitutionalism will thus have to offer modes of adapting open norms to an ever changing and developing societal reality. The chapter outlines a framework for such constitutionalism which, at the same time, offers opportunities for reconciling the social and economic dimensions in the European integration project through a re-configured notion of constitutionalism.

Expansion of the meat inspection process to incorporate animal-based welfare measurements could contribute towards significant improvements in pig (Sus scrofa domesticus) welfare and farm profitability. This study aimed to determine the prevalence of different welfare-related lesions on the carcase and their relationship with carcase condemnations (CC) and carcase weight (CW). The financial implications of losses associated with CC and CW reductions related to the welfare lesions were also estimated. Data on tail lesions, loin bruising and bursitis, CW and condemnation/trimming outcome (and associated weights) were collected for 3,537slaughter pigs (mean [± SEM] carcase weight: 79.2 [± 8.82] kg). Overall, 72.5% of pigs had detectable tail lesions, whilst 16.0 and 44.0% were affected by severe loin bruising and hind limb bursitis, respectively. There were 2.5% of study carcases condemned and a further 3.3% were trimmed. The primary cause of CC was abscessation. While tail lesion severity did not increase the risk of abscessation, it was significantly associated with CC. Male pigs had a higher risk of tail lesions and of CC. The financial loss to producers associated with CC and trimmings was estimated at €1.10 per study pig. CW was reduced by up to 12 kg in cases of severe tail lesions. However, even mild lesions were associated with a significant reduction in CW of 1.2 kg. The value of the loss in potential CW associated with tail lesions was €0.59 per study pig. Combined with losses attributable to CC and trimmings this represented a loss of 43% of the profit margin per pig, at the time of the study, attributable to tail biting. These findings illustrate the magnitude of the impact of tail biting on pig welfare and on profitability of the pig industry. They also emphasise the potential contribution that the inclusion of welfare parameters at meat inspection could make to pig producers in informing herd health and welfare management plans.

Introduction Tensions between the economic and the social dimensions of European integration are being perceived as increasing, and so is the potential for conflict between national and European levels of policy-making. Both are well illustrated by a highly controversial line of Court of Justice of the European Union (ECJ) cases on industrial relations: Viking and Laval have become symbols for the continuing dominance of the economic over the social dimension of European integration and for an increasing tendency of the EU to diminish national autonomy. As one consequence, demands to protect Member States’ social policy choices from EU law pressures arise. For such demands to be tenable, isolation of national and EU policy-making and of economic and social dimensions of European integration would have to be possible. This is arguably not the case. Economic and social dimensions of integration will thus have to be reconciled across EU and national levels, if the EU and its Member States are to maintain the ability of enhancing social justice against the pulls of economic globalisation.

Bioenergy derived from biomass provides a promising energy alternative and can reduce the greenhouse gas (GHG) emissions generated from fossil fuels. Biomass-based thermochemical conversion technologies have been acknowledged as apt options to convert bioresources into bioenergy; this bioenergy includes electricity, heat, and fuels/chemicals in solid, liquid, and gaseous phases. In this review, the techno-economic and life cycle assessment of these technologies (combustion, gasification, pyrolysis, liquefaction, carbonization, and co-firing) are summarized. Specific indicators (production costs in a techno-economic analysis, functional units and environmental impacts in a life cycle analysis) for different technologies were compared. Finally, gaps in research and future trends in biomass thermochemical conversion were identified. This review could be used to guide future research related to economic and environmental benefits of bioenergy.

Displacement of fossil fuel-based power through biomass co-firing could reduce the greenhouse gas (GHG) emissions from fossil fuels. In this study, data-intensive techno-economic models were developed to evaluate different co-firing technologies as well as the configurations of these technologies. The models were developed to study 60 different scenarios involving various biomass feedstocks (wood chips, wheat straw, and forest residues) co-fired either with coal in a 500 MW subcritical pulverized coal (PC) plant or with natural gas in a 500 MW natural gas combined cycle (NGCC) plant to determine their technical potential and costs, as well as to determine environmental benefits. The results obtained reveal that the fully paid-off coal-fired power plant co-fired with forest residues is the most attractive option, having levelized costs of electricity (LCOE) of $53.12–$54.50/MW h and CO2 abatement costs of $27.41–$31.15/tCO2. When whole forest chips are co-fired with coal in a fully paid-off plant, the LCOE and CO2 abatement costs range from $54.68 to $56.41/MW h and $35.60 to $41.78/tCO2, respectively. The LCOE and CO2 abatement costs for straw range from $54.62 to $57.35/MW h and $35.07 to $38.48/tCO2, respectively.
